These GPUs from NVIDIA's RTX 40 series offer next-gen DLSS 3, improved ray tracing, and power efficiency. Below is a breakdown of each model from Gigabyte and MSI.
GeForce RTX 4070 (Gigabyte / MSI)
CUDA Cores: 5,888
VRAM: 12GB GDDR6X (192-bit)
Boost Clock: ~2,475 MHz (varies by model)
Power Consumption: ~200W
Ports: HDMI 2.1, 3x DisplayPort 1.4a
Performance: 1440p Ultra Gaming @ 100+ FPS
Features: DLSS 3, 3rd Gen Ray Tracing, AV1 Encoder
Best for: High FPS gaming in 1440p with Ray Tracing & DLSS 3.
GeForce RTX 4070 Ti (Gigabyte / MSI)
CUDA Cores: 7,680
VRAM: 12GB GDDR6X (192-bit)
Boost Clock: ~2,610 MHz
Power Consumption: ~285W
Performance: 4K Gaming @ 60+ FPS / 1440p Extreme Settings
Cooling: Triple-fan (WINDFORCE / TWIN FROZR 8)
Extra: 2x HDMI 2.1, 3x DisplayPort 1.4a
Best for: 4K gaming & professional creative workloads (Adobe Premiere, Blender).
GeForce RTX 4060 Ti (Gigabyte / MSI)
CUDA Cores: 4,352
VRAM: 8GB or 16GB GDDR6 (128-bit)
Boost Clock: ~2,500 MHz
Power Consumption: 160W
Performance: 1080p Ultra Gaming @ 120+ FPS
Cooling: Dual-fan / Triple-fan (depends on brand)
Extra: DLSS 3, AI frame generation, AV1 Encoder
Best for: High FPS gaming in 1080p / entry-level 1440p. The 16GB version is better for content creation.
GeForce RTX 4060 (Gigabyte / MSI)
CUDA Cores: 3,072
VRAM: 8GB GDDR6 (128-bit)
Boost Clock: ~2,460 MHz
Power Consumption: 115W
Performance: 1080p Gaming @ 80-100 FPS
Extra: Energy efficient (great for small builds)
Best for: Budget-friendly 1080p gaming with DLSS 3 support.
Which One Should You Get?
RTX 4070 Ti – Best for 4K & high-end 1440p gaming
RTX 4070 – 1440p Ultra gaming with high FPS
RTX 4060 Ti – Best 1080p GPU (some 1440p support)
RTX 4060 – Affordable & power-efficient for 1080p
